(2015) is a critically acclaimed Indian Hindi-language romantic comedy-drama set in the 1990s. Directed by Sharat Katariya and produced by Yash Raj Films, it stars Ayushmann Khurrana as Prem, a shy music shop owner, and Bhumi Pednekar in her debut role as Sandhya, an educated, overweight woman. Movie Summary

Set in Haridwar in the 1990s, Dum Laga Ke Haisha follows Prem (Khurrana), a struggling cassette-store owner who runs a business of playing songs on demand. Pressured by his family, he enters an arranged marriage with Sandhya (Pednekar), an educated, confident woman who is overweight. Prem, immature and embarrassed by her size, treats her with disdain. The film charts their rocky relationship, her quiet strength, and a climax set around a quirky couple’s race where they must literally pull together— dum laga ke (with all their might).

From the hum of audio cassettes to the soulful melodies of Kumar Sanu, the film perfectly captures a pre-digital India.
